Canadians using Cogeco

Anyone here in Canada that is using a Hitron modem, you can get a Sagemcom that has fiber/cox capabilities with Wifi 6, no need for a router. I haven’t got mine yet, as im so tired of this hitron issues im having, but when i do i will be fully testing. This means you dont need a wifi 6 router or need to bridge your modem. You can also control it with the app now and it works with the pods. They tell me the pods are wifi 6 enabled as well.

Update:

I have wifi 6 going on the modem, the iptv box called epico is a google tv box which has full access to the play store. Which means i can install VPN, downloader and all other apps to stream. This is pretty good news as typically ISP supplied stuff is typically locked.

I have put on a vpn and streamio so far, the other stuff needs the downloader which i have put on.

Copy…I see your gateway has 32/8 bonded channels & DOC 3.1…so as far as a modem connecting to the internet, you are about as current as what the ISPs are using…DOCSIS 3.2 I don’t believe has become mainstream with ISP equipment as of yet, but I could be wrong on that cause I don’t follow closely anymore. The router part of your gateway probably has some newer bells & whistles in it also…besides the wifi 6 capabilities.
